    For those wondering about quality, these are 18/0 stainless steel which is pretty lightweight and “cheaper” feeling. They probably won’t last as long as silverware that is 18/10 and would be more susceptible from nicks from banging around or falling into your disposal. 18/10 is pretty expensive though so if you have kids/family that lose silverware or take it to work and never bring it back, it’s a great deal. Also great for anyone living with roommates with no respect, dorms etc.
